By any standard whatsoever, Electric Light Orchestra is one of the most remarkable success stories in rock history. Consider just the facts: ELO has sold over 50 million records worldwide, and continues to be a remarkably popular catalog. Between 1972 and 1986 Jeff Lynne wrote and produced twenty six Top 40 hits in the UK and twenty in the US, including twenty Top 20 smashes in the UK and 15 in the US. With ELO, Lynne brought the world a different sound that remains modern, relevant and influential to this very day.

1974’s Eldorado: A Symphony by the Electric Light Orchestra, is the group’s breakthrough fourth studio album and first conceptual release. Their most ambitious album to date, Lynne decided to hire a 30 piece orchestra and choir to fill out the band’s sound, and the investment paid off in spades. Lynne finally found the rich symphonic presence he had been searching for since ELO’s inception and produced the group’s biggest single up to that point with “Can’t Get It Out of My Head” along the way.
